Study of ion induced instability in BTCF

  • 1. Academia Sinica, Beijing (China). Inst. of High Energy Physics

Description

The ion induced instabilities in the electron ring of the proposed Beijing τ-charm factory (BTCF) are studied. First, the authors calculated the length of the filling gap which can clear the ions produced in last turn, then simulated the process of the fast beam-ion instability in BTCF and obtained its growth time, which is consistent with the theoretical prediction
